Yellow Bird

Yellow Bird

Developed  by the Brooklyn Botanic Garden in Brooklyn, New York, this yellow flowering deciduous magnolia is one of the best. 'Yellow Bird’ is a cross between M. acuminata var. subcordata and M. x brooklynensis ‘Evamaria’ and flowers nicely for 2 to 3 weeks as the leaves emerge in the spring. Excellent color consistency and precocious flowering are some of the qualities. The tree grow fairly fast, and will become 20 ft tall in time.  Hardy to zone 4.
